Intel EP2AGX95EF25I5N is a Field Programmable Gate Array from the EP2AGX95 series, featuring 89,178 logic cells and 3,747 CLBs. This device operates at a maximum clock frequency of 500MHz and is housed in a 572-ball Plastic Ball Grid Array (PBGA) package with a terminal pitch of 1.00mm. The operating temperature range is -40°C to +100°C, with a nominal supply voltage of 0.9V. It supports 260 inputs and 260 outputs. This component is suitable for applications in industrial, communications, and computing sectors requiring high-performance, reconfigurable logic solutions.
